#2e3bb0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2e3bb0 is composed of 18% red, 23.1% green and 69%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.9% cyan, 66.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 234 degrees, a saturation of 58.6% and a lightness of 43.5%. #2e3bb0 color hex could be obtained by blending #5c76ff with #000061.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

Shades and Tints of #2e3bb0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010205 is the darkest color, while #f4f5fc is the lightest one.
